Dedicated to The Care of Elders:
PACE (Program of All-Inclusive Care for the Elderly) was developed to answer the many problems around caring for frail seniors. The PACE model is centered on the belief that it is better for the well-being of seniors with chronic care needs and their families to be served in their community whenever possible.
Seniors their family members and caregivers face many issues including transportation to appointments management of medications coordination of medical care from different specialists lack of social interaction and ability to stay alone at home. On Lok PACE participants receive in home care services and transportation to a On Lok PACE center for primary medical care social and recreational activities and other senior care services.

POSITION SUMMARY: The Caregiver provides personal care services to On Lok participants receiving home care and/or day center services.
DUTIES / RESPONSIBILITIES:
- Provides personal care/escort assistance according to the individual care plan (i.e. grooming dressing peri-care showers bathing toileting housekeeping meal preparation/feeding laundry) and reports observed changes in the participants condition to the interdisciplinary team.
- Demonstrates safe practices by utilizing proper body mechanics adhering to universal precautions and maintaining environmental safety.
- Interacts and provides services to participants families and interdisciplinary team in a professional manner (i.e. encourage participation in conversation and activities).
- Provides onboarding and ongoing training for other Caregivers using manuals and formal training materials as a guide.
- Active participation in departmental meetings and family meetings as needed.
- Other related duties as assigned.
